We have edited the dsenv to add the DB2 library path and restarted the dsengine and then ASBAgent.When the ./uv -admin -start command is issued it finished with the error below
DataStage Engine 8.7.0.0 instance "ade" has been brought up.
Starting JobMonApp
JobMonApp has been started.sh: module: line 1: syntax error: unexpected end of file
sh: error importing function definition for `module'
resource_tracker has been started.
Then we ran the the parallel job which has a sequential file and a db2 api stage.The job reports completion but there is a blank fatal error and the following information messgae :
Our dsenv file is as follows:Contents of phantom output file
ERROR: ld.so: object 'SH'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'module'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'line'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object '1'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'syntax'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'error'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'unexpected'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'end'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'of'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'fileSH'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'error'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'importing'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'function'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'definition'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'for'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object '`module'/opt/IBM/InformationServer/Server/DSComponents/lib/libicui18n.so'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'SH'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'module'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'line'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object '1'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'syntax'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'error'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'unexpected'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'end'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'of'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'fileSH'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'error'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'importing'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'function'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'definition'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object 'for' from LD_PRELOAD cannot be preloaded: ignored.
ERROR: ld.so: object '`module'/opt/IBM/InformationServer/Server/DSComponents/lib/libicui18n.so' from LD_PRELOAD cannot be preloaded: ignored.
SH: module: line 1: syntax error: unexpected end of file
SH: error importing function definition for `module'
Please help in resolving this issue# PLATFORM SPECIFIC SECTION
set +u
if [ -z "$DSHOME" ] && [ -f "/.dshome" ]
then
DSHOME=`cat /.dshome`
export DSHOME
fi
if [ -z "$DSHOME" ]
then
DSHOME=/opt/IBM/InformationServer/Server/DSEngine; export DSHOME
fi
if [ -z "$DSRPCD_PORT_NUMBER" ]
then
true
DSRPCD_PORT_NUMBER=31538; export DSRPCD_PORT_NUMBER
fi
if [ -z "$APT_ORCHHOME" ]
then
APT_ORCHHOME=/opt/IBM/InformationServer/Server/PXEngine; export APT_ORCHHOME
fi
#if [ -z "$UDTHOME" ]
#then
UDTHOME=/opt/IBM/InformationServer/Server/DSEngine/ud41 ; export UDTHOME
UDTBIN=/opt/IBM/InformationServer/Server/DSEngine/ud41/bin ; export UDTBIN
#fi
#if [ -z "$ASBHOME" ] && [ -f "$DSHOME/.asbnode" ]
#then
ASBHOME=`cat $DSHOME/.asbnode`
export ASBHOME
#fi
#if [ -z "$ASBHOME" ]
#then
#ASBHOME=`dirname \`dirname $DSHOME\``/ASBNode
#export ASBHOME
#fi
if [ -n "$DSHOME" ] && [ -d "$DSHOME" ]
then
ODBCINI=$DSHOME/.odbc.ini; export ODBCINI
HOME=${HOME:-/}; export HOME
#LANG="<langdef>";export LANG
#LC_ALL="<langdef>";export LC_ALL
#LC_CTYPE="<langdef>";export LC_CTYPE
#LC_COLLATE="<langdef>";export LC_COLLATE
#LC_MONETARY="<langdef>";export LC_MONETARY
#LC_NUMERIC="<langdef>";export LC_NUMERIC
#LC_TIME="<langdef>";export LC_TIME
#LC_MESSAGES="<langdef>"; export LC_MESSAGES
LD_LIBRARY_PATH=`dirname $DSHOME`/branded_odbc/lib:`dirname $DSHOME`/DSComponents/lib:`dirname $DSHOME`/DSComponents/bin:$DSHOME/lib:$DSHOME/uvdlls:`dirname $DSHOME`/PXEngine/lib:$ASBHOME/apps/jre/bin:$ASBHOME/apps/jre/bin/classic:$ASBHOME/lib/cpp:$ASBHOME/apps/proxy/cpp/linux-all-x86_64:$LD_LIBRARY_PATH
export LD_LIBRARY_PATH
LD_PRELOAD=`dirname $DSHOME`/DSComponents/lib/libicui18n.so
export LD_PRELOAD
# PATH=/home/db2inst1/sqllib/bin:$PATH;
# export PATH
fi